With that many support toons, you should be defense hard capped most of the time from incarnate powers and leadership alone. 

 

Bots is a solid set; they're damage isn't high tier, but that doesn't matter for this event.  They can support themselves pretty well without much babysitting.

Ninjas can work, but realize you will be busy herding cats the entire time, and they even may stop rendering once they run off into oblivion.  For this event, it's about fun first and foremost; pick a primary that seems fun to you and secondary that you can handle and is interesting to use.

 

I'd avoid /FF unless you take a bunch of attacks to keep you busy during the event. 

With /Rad needing to use toggles to debuff, you may run into trouble trying to target mobs with so many pets around.  You still have the heal and accelerate metabolism , along with personal attacks, so /Rad would still effective. 

/Thermal is another solid pick.  I'm sure everyone will be resist capped, however, you also have two heals, two debuffs, forge, and personal attacks, if you pick any.
